Output 93069efa6f1221107f4220b96a912750891096752d9f7353cba8b0c01ed13d37:0

value
670700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da627f54b8e6e317b73231e6528b0c6b0135369c OP_EQUAL
address
3MbjE5fLY7h2WLPQ4zxAu7fYE7CUUGvdvF
transaction
93069efa6f1221107f4220b96a912750891096752d9f7353cba8b0c01ed13d37
spent
true